Located south of Angers, Les Terres Blanches has a unique and exceptional terroir made of clay and granite soils with a limestone and slate origins. The estate consists of a collection of small plots in a landscape naturally protected by trees, groves, meadows and bird sanctuaries. Since their arrival in 2004, Céline and Benoit have replanted 5 hectares of vines from their own premium grafts (selection massals) to ensure a human and ecological balance. All of their production is harvested, vinified and bottled at the estate.

Vinification: Grapes are harvested by hand and fermentation begins following the "Pet-Nat" approach with a twist! After resting on the lees following fermentation, the wines are disgorged for release!
